Output 62e7340b59934d35cf95fd2beab4d3c518bec6fdbee81606c53f4fe362751725:3

value
142170684
script pubkey
OP_0 OP_PUSHBYTES_20 6af1bff7d3005041cd16d65e830b4e1024628a54
address
ltc1qdtcmla7nqpgyrngk6e0gxz6wzqjx9zj5xgcs7h
transaction
62e7340b59934d35cf95fd2beab4d3c518bec6fdbee81606c53f4fe362751725
spent
true